Former President Donald Trump recently gave his endorsement to Republican Senate candidate Dave McCormick in Pennsylvania, praising his character and intelligence. McCormick, a former hedge fund executive and West Point graduate, is running unopposed in the state’s primary and will face Democratic Sen. Bob Casey Jr. in November. The Senate race is crucial as the Republicans aim to win back the majority in the chamber, with Democrats currently holding a slim lead.

Trump’s endorsement of McCormick comes after a contentious GOP primary battle in 2022, where he narrowly lost to celebrity doctor Mehmet Oz, despite Trump’s last-minute endorsement of Oz. McCormick had endorsed Trump earlier in the year after the former president’s successes in the Super Tuesday contests. Trump’s endorsement of McCormick this time around signifies a united front within the party as they aim to win back key battleground states.

Pennsylvania is one of six battleground states where Joe Biden narrowly edged out Trump in the previous presidential election. Most recent polls in the state suggest a close contest between the two candidates for the state’s electoral votes. Biden is set to kick off a three-day swing through Pennsylvania, highlighting his plans to raise taxes on the wealthiest Americans and corporations, as he emphasizes the economic contrasts between himself and Trump.

Meanwhile, Trump is facing a trial in New York City for 34 state felony charges related to hush-money payments made to adult film actress Stormy Daniels during the 2016 election.
